Transaction 84dac79f57411d2be815f35cc5ae782c645b6c343f66da30df02507e6ec16b9e

1 Input
2 Outputs
  • 84dac79f57411d2be815f35cc5ae782c645b6c343f66da30df02507e6ec16b9e:0
  • value  529480
    address  38CNoEernSjfdTpBNAX9NGiBCoDCu1aMGc
  • 84dac79f57411d2be815f35cc5ae782c645b6c343f66da30df02507e6ec16b9e:1
  • value  2123538
    address  1A5ihgKc3KJ7MJKPdJMTbBz1FszCYZCeQU